Hi,欢迎来到南京华清远见,南京及周边地区专业的嵌入式/Android/JavaEE/HTML5/VR、AR培训基地!
南京华清远见分中心是Android培训、嵌入式培训知名品牌
当前位置: > 南京IT培训 > 就业快讯 > 就业感言 >
如何成为嵌入式软件工程师 秘诀原来是这样
时间:2016-08-15来源:华清远见嵌入式学院南京中心
   
  学员姓名:曹宝果
  毕业学校:江苏大学
  所学专业:测控技术与仪器
  就业单位:寰坤通讯
  学员薪资:8800
   
 

我是曹宝果,毕业于江苏大学测控技术与仪器专业,毕业后从事嵌入式硬件工作一年半,在工作的过程中逐渐发现自己的对嵌入式软件的兴趣,同时也想对嵌入式系统有一个系统的认识,自己在职自学一段时间后发现效果很差,所以最终决定离职,集中时间学习嵌入式软件。

由于现有的很多嵌入式实时操作系统都是通过裁剪Linux系统完成的,所以完成Linux系统的学习,对再去学习其他的嵌入式操作系统都有很大的帮助,这也是我选择学习嵌入式Linux的原因之一。我是在网上搜索到华清远见的,感觉以前学员对这个培训机构的评价不错,就在去年年底找寇老师咨询了很多问题,今年三月份办理完离职手续就开始了为期四个月的嵌入式Linux的学习。

华清的学习氛围比较好,大家基本上平均每天的学习时间超过13个小时,做电子词典小项目那会有同学甚至晚上一点回宿舍。华清的授课老师很负责、技术能力也非常棒,C语言基础学习、Linux C高级编程、数据结构与算法、ARM、Linux系统移植、驱动编写、java安卓等每个老师在所教的课程方面都有很深的见解,再加上我以前做嵌入式硬件的基础,使得我对嵌入式有了更深的理解。

在华清的四个月,一方面我嵌入式软件开发技能有了很大的提升,使得我能有底气进入这个领域;另外一方面我体会到不管是做嵌入式软件也好,还是做其他事情也好,底层基础知识很重要,C语言基本语法和C语言数据结构是也相当于嵌入式的整个地基吧,掌握好对以后的工作大有帮助,记得华清的老师给我们推荐的《C语言深度解析》,这本书我看了很多遍,但是每一次看都能有新的收获;还有一方面,做什么事情都不要着急,这是我在找工作的过程中冀老师教导我的,深有体会,非常感谢冀老师。

我对教授数据结构的汪老师和教授驱动的彭老师的印象很深刻,汪老师教授的数据结构本身很难懂,但是他能用生活小事当做例子来让我们理解数据结构,把比较晦涩难懂的数据结构讲解的生动有趣,又有营养。彭老师工作经验丰富,对很多技术问题都有很深的理解,理论和实践经验都很强,课堂代码都是边上课边实现的,而且除了教我们编写驱动代码外,还教我们怎么利用现有工具如有道云笔记、source insight等软件提高编程和学习效率。

我的工作是通过公司过来宣讲并且在刘老师推荐下找到的,刘老师和冀老师也给我们推荐了很多别的企业,单是靠两位老师的推荐,我的面试也安排的满满的,找工作这几天气温达到了38度,两位老师为我们工作在外面奔波也是蛮拼的,老师安排的面试都是这边合作很久的企业,大家不要轻易放弃哦。

分享一下找工作和学习的几点感悟:

1、学习整理很重要:我每天上课都是老师一边讲我一边在下面记笔记或者跟着老师敲代码,晚上再花一到两个小时把当天学习的内容整理起来成word文档,以后每次遇到类似问题,再去翻笔记,如果笔记没有就再补充笔记,四个月学完这些都是我的财富。

2、方向选择:驱动或者Linux C开发主要靠自己的兴趣或者以前的工作经验来选择,其实嵌入式开发软硬不分家的,同样嵌入式软件驱动和应用也是不分家的,所以这是一个从上到下或者从下到上的过程。

3、基础很重要:大家要重视C语言和数据结构(特别是链表操作),重要事情再说一遍,基础很重要。

4、找工作不要着急,面包总会有的,这点我需要再次反思。

5、最后的项目很重要:一方面可以整合四个月的学习内容,另一方面为面试增加筹码,像我之前对IPC对象的使用也是一知半解,通过这个项目我才理解的比较深,然后面试的时候被问到,当然可以说出来了。

最后再次感谢各位老师的辛苦,感谢冀老师和刘校长,尤其感谢娜姐四个月来对我们的帮助。同时祝各位都能找到满意的工作,祝华清家庭越来越大,祝各位老师工作顺利。

发表评论

365体育在线投注台湾 - 专注于南京IT培训,江苏及周边地区专业的嵌入式/Android/JavaEE/HTML5/VR、AR培训基地!

全国咨询热线:400-611-6270,双休日及节假日请致电值班手机:13914725010(24小时)

Copyright 2004-2018 华清远见教育集团 版权所有 ,京ICP备16055225号,京公海网安备11010802025203号

免费在线咨询立即咨询

免费索取技术资料立即索取

嵌入式技术交流群QQ:330864365

电话咨询400-611-6270